压力测试工具能否安装在被测的WEB服务器上进行本地的压力测试?
参考答案:
压力测试工具一般不建议安装在被测的WEB服务器上进行本地的压力测试。主要原因是进行压力测试时,无论是发压还是被压都会占用资源。当系统出现瓶颈时,如果压力测试工具和被测服务器安装在同一台机器上,会对结果分析造成很大的影响。因此,为了确保测试的准确性和可靠性,一般要求发压和被压机器分离,这样更便于分析压测结果。
当然,也存在一些特殊情况。例如,当上层请求是同内网下的同IDC的调用方法时,可以选择使用同一IDC的机器进行发压。此外,如果预期QPS(每秒查询率)很低,且测试目的只是验证一些简单的并发问题,如内存泄漏等,那么在同一台机器上进行混布测试也是可以接受的。
总的来说,是否能在被测的WEB服务器上进行本地的压力测试取决于具体的测试需求和场景。在大多数情况下,为了获得更准确和可靠的测试结果,建议将压力测试工具安装在独立的机器上进行测试。